Going After GOD?

"God is spirit, and those who worship Him must worship in spirit and truth." John 4:24 I often hear people say they are "going after God." That sounds good, but what does it really mean? Since God relentlessly pursues us, we shouldn't have to "go after" Him, we should just be living a life that reflects His Character and focusing on being more like Him. Our spirit man (or woman) should be in tune with The Holy Spirit. We should be alert to what The Spirit is saying to us & what He desires to do in and through us. We must allow God to strip away anything in us that is not of Him, anything that is contrary to His Nature. Conversely, we must allow Him to grow, cultivate & mature those things that are representative of Him. True worship pleases GOD--worship that is pure, that comes from a grateful and true heart. However, sometimes we worship the experience of worship, rather than truly worshipping Him. We get caught up in the moment--the noise, the lights the spectacle of it all--and miss worshipping GOD as our Creator, or Savior, our Source of Life and Love. Instead, we should simply worship Him and allow ourselves to be lost in Him. For great is the LORD and greatly to be praised; Psalm 96:4 What, then, is our motive for worship? Are we just going through the motions? Is it out of a sense of obligation, habit or routine? Now, therefore, fear the LORD and serve Him in sincerity and truth; Joshua 24:14 What does it mean to fear the Lord? Truly we have reason to fear or be afraid of Him if we aren't living as we should be, but the fear of the Lord is more of a reverential awe of Him & Who He is. If our concept of God is one of Him sitting & waiting for us to mess up so He can punish us, our view of Him is incorrect. Yes, God is a God of judgement for those living in sin--but, He is a God of love, mercy & grace for those who love & live for Him. We love, because He first loved us. 1 John 4:19 Our character should reflect His. If we are living in accordance with His Will & His Plan for us, we have no reason to "go after" Him, we should simply bask in Who He is and seek to share Him with those who are wandering from the truth.
